## Deploying the Gatewick Proctor Queue

Deploys are pretty painless: push to main, wait for the pipeline, then watch the queue drain dashboard for five minutes. If candidates pile up mid-exam, roll back first and ask questions later — the queue replays safely. Everything the workers care about lives in one config block, shown here for reference.

settings of bafof-yagef:
JOROX_PIN=8740
JOROX_TENANT=pelox
JOROX_METRICS_HOST=metrics.jorox.qorvelworks.internal
JOROX_SEAL=seal_c78f63c1
JOROX_STANDBY_TEAM=norax

Handover Note — Currency Hedging

Director Penrose, as you assume oversight of treasury, please note we recently moved to hedge 70% of our Varent-denominated exposure through forward contracts arranged via Stonegate Capital. Heads of department have been briefed on the operational effects only. The full position schedule sits with the treasury file; review it carefully before the next committee. The strategic context for this decision follows below.

internal memo for fahif-hahip: The board signed off on a budget of $27.9 million for Project Zordor.

## Runbook: GreenLoop Sensor Drift Hotfix

Hey on-call — if the GreenLoop controller starts reporting humidity creeping up 2–3% per day with no actual change in the greenhouse, that's the known drift bug in firmware 4.1.x. Don't recalibrate the sensors by hand; it masks the problem and breaks the averaging window. Instead, push the 4.1.4 hotfix bundle to the affected zone controllers. The bundles must be signed before the units will accept them, and signing uses the key below.

deploy key for kajof-fajop: bky6_gDHw9Q